What is the Goethe Language Proficiency Certificate?
Administered by the Goethe-Institut, the cultural institute of the Federal Republic of Germany, these language certificates are worldwide recognized by companies, universities, and federal government authorities. Based on the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R), the tests assess a prospect's efficiency across 4 core abilities: Reading, Listening, Writing, and Speaking.
The certificates span 6 levels, varying from absolute beginners to near-native speakers:
- A1 & & A2: Elementary Language Use
- B1 & & B2: Independent Language Use
- C1 & & C2: Proficient Language Use

The Traditional Path: How to Earn the Certificate
For prospects who wish to sit for the main assessments, the process needs structured preparation, registration, and screening.
Step-by-Step Examination Process
- Evaluate Current Level: Take a positioning test to figure out whether to study for A1, B2, C1, etc.
- Prepare Thoroughly: Utilize Goethe-Institut textbooks, online courses, and practice examinations. Focus heavily on output skills (writing and speaking).
- Register Online: Visit the main Goethe-Institut website or a licensed local partner (such as a Goethe-Zentrum) to reserve an examination slot. Slots fill quickly, so book months beforehand.
- Take the Exam: Complete both the written modules (Reading, Listening, Writing) and the oral module (Speaking, which is often performed in person with examiners).
- Get Results: Results are normally published within 2 to six weeks. Upon passing, candidates get a physical certificate with lifetime validity.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. For how long is a Goethe language certificate valid?
Goethe-Institut certificates do not have an expiration date. Once earned, they stay legitimate for life. Nevertheless, some universities or employers might ask for a more current certificate (e.g., within the last two years) if they think your language abilities have actually broken down due to lack of use.

5. What is the distinction in between TestDAF and the Goethe C1 certificate?
While both show sophisticated German efficiency for university admission, TestDAF is heavily academic and standardized into particular scoring bands (TDN 3, 4, and 5). The Goethe-Zertifikat C1 is a more basic proficiency exam that assesses holistic language usage in academic, social, and expert contexts.
